Why should homeowners even care about chimney maintenance? Because every time wood or gas burns, soot and residue coat the inside of the flue. If not cleaned, this buildup becomes flammable and restricts airflow. Poor airflow increases carbon monoxide risks, while damaged masonry lets moisture in, weakening the entire structure. A reliable sweep doesn’t just clean; they also perform chimney inspection, fireplace repair, and even gas fireplace maintenance when needed. By choosing the right team, you protect your home, your wallet, and your family’s safety.
What issues do most homeowners face with chimneys? Here are a few common ones:
Creosote buildup: Sticky, flammable residue that increases fire risks.
Damaged flashing: Causes leaks around the chimney where it meets the roof.
Cracked crown: Leads to water intrusion and brick deterioration.
Flue blockages: From leaves, bird nests, or animal entry.
Mortar erosion: Weakens the structure and shortens chimney life.

So where does a chimney cleaner fit in? Their role is more than just brushing out soot. A professional evaluates every part of the system, from the chimney cap to the fireplace insert. They ensure the flue liner is intact, the smoke chamber functions correctly, and no obstructions hinder draft. They also recommend if fireplace repair or gas fireplace maintenance is needed. In other words, the cleaner is both technician and safety inspector—someone you rely on to prevent fire hazards before they happen.

How can a homeowner stay safe when using a fireplace? Always schedule yearly inspections, even if you don’t use the fireplace often. Ensure the chimney cap is intact to keep debris and animals out. Never burn trash, cardboard, or wet wood. Install carbon monoxide detectors in rooms near the fireplace. And most importantly, don’t delay professional service when you notice smoke backup, unusual odors, or crumbling masonry. Safety always starts with prevention.

1. How often should a chimney be cleaned?
At least once a year, even if you don’t use it often.
2. What’s the difference between a chimney sweep and chimney inspection?
A sweep removes buildup, while an inspection checks for damage or risks.
3. Can I clean my chimney myself?
DIY kits exist, but professionals have tools and training for safe, thorough work.
4. How much does chimney cleaning cost in Ann Arbor?
Typically $150–$300 depending on buildup and system size.
5. What signs mean I need fireplace repair?
Smoke inside, cracks in masonry, or difficulty starting a draft.
6. Do gas fireplaces need maintenance?
Yes, gas fireplace maintenance ensures burners, vents, and seals stay safe.
7. What causes chimney leaks?
Damaged flashing, cracked crowns, or missing caps.
8. How do I find the best chimney services near me?
Look for certified, reviewed, and insured contractors with clear pricing.
9. Can animals really get stuck in chimneys?
Yes, birds, squirrels, and raccoons often build nests inside.
10. What’s the benefit of waterproofing a chimney?
It prevents water damage that leads to costly masonry repairs.
